Las Vegas (USA), Nov 23 (LaPresse) – Max Verstappen won the Las Vegas GP, the third-to-last race of the Formula One World Championship, finishing ahead of Lando Norris (who started from pole) and George Russell. The Red Bull driver remains in the title fight with two races and one Sprint to go, but it is now Norris who is closest to winning the World Championship, with a 30-point lead in the overall standings over his teammate Oscar Piastri (who finished fourth) and 42 points ahead of Verstappen. Charles Leclerc’s Ferrari finished only sixth, behind even Kimi Antonelli’s Mercedes. The Italian driver made a comeback from 17th to fifth, also having to serve a 5-second penalty for a false start at the finish line, which prevented him from passing Piastri. Tenth place for the other Ferrari of Lewis Hamilton.
